Output 26f741ac37794cb830ba03c47f5b40a52432fcfd19a449b1beb0b830d8bce19b:5

value
3543790
script pubkey
OP_0 OP_PUSHBYTES_20 23bd9dc6efdb2f1d8c9889a71871a219079247fc
address
bc1qyw7em3h0mvh3mryc3xn3sudzryrey3luuyyfkx
transaction
26f741ac37794cb830ba03c47f5b40a52432fcfd19a449b1beb0b830d8bce19b
confirmations
85656
spent
true